- The distance between Aleksandrovsk-Sahal, Russia and Ethelda Bay, Bc, Canada is approximately 5,646 km or 3,508 mi.
- To reach Aleksandrovsk-Sahal in this distance one would set out from Ethelda Bay, Bc bearing 305.5°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Aleksandrovsk-Sahal bearing 230.9° or SW .
- Aleksandrovsk-Sahal has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Ethelda Bay, Bc has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Aleksandrovsk-Sahal is in or near the boreal wet forest biome whereas Ethelda Bay, Bc is in or near the cool temperate rain forest bi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 7.3 °C (13.1°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 22.6 °C (40.7°F) more in Aleksandrovsk-Sahal.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 2651.8 mm (104.4 in) less which is equivalent to 2651.8 l/m² (65.08 US gal/ft²) or 26,518,000 l/ha (2,834,950 US gal/ac) less. About 1/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 2.1° higher in Aleksandrovsk-Sahal than in Ethelda Bay, Bc.
